Condividi tramite


Funzione SetupDiGetHwProfileFriendlyNameA (setupapi.h)

La funzione SetupDiGetHwProfileFriendlyName recupera il nome descrittivo associato a un ID profilo hardware.

Sintassi

WINSETUPAPI BOOL SetupDiGetHwProfileFriendlyNameA(
  [in]            DWORD  HwProfile,
  [out]           PSTR   FriendlyName,
  [in]            DWORD  FriendlyNameSize,
  [out, optional] PDWORD RequiredSize
);

Parametri

[in] HwProfile

ID del profilo hardware associato al nome descrittivo da recuperare. Se questo parametro è 0, viene recuperato il nome descrittivo per il profilo hardware corrente.

[out] FriendlyName

Puntatore a un buffer di stringhe per ricevere il nome descrittivo.

[in] FriendlyNameSize

Dimensione, in caratteri, del buffer FriendlyName.

[out, optional] RequiredSize

Puntatore a una variabile di tipo DWORD che riceve il numero di caratteri necessari per recuperare il nome descrittivo (incluso un carattere di terminazione NULL).

Valore restituito

Se ha esito positivo, la funzione restituisce TRUE. In caso contrario, restituisce FALSE e l'errore registrato può essere recuperato effettuando una chiamata a GetLastError.

Osservazioni

Chiamare SetupDiGetHwProfileFriendlyNameEx per ottenere il nome descrittivo di un ID profilo hardware in un computer remoto.

Nota

L'intestazione setupapi.h definisce SetupDiGetHwProfileFriendlyName come alias che seleziona automaticamente la versione ANSI o Unicode di questa funzione in base alla definizione della costante del preprocessore UNICODE. La combinazione dell'utilizzo dell'alias indipendente dalla codifica con il codice non indipendente dalla codifica può causare mancate corrispondenze che generano errori di compilazione o di runtime. Per altre informazioni, vedere convenzioni di per i prototipi di funzioni.

Fabbisogno

Requisito Valore
client minimo supportato Disponibile in Microsoft Windows 2000 e versioni successive di Windows.
piattaforma di destinazione Desktop
intestazione setupapi.h (include Setupapi.h)
libreria Setupapi.lib

Vedere anche

SetupDiGetHwProfileFriendlyNameEx

SetupDiGetHwProfileList